Achieving an Even Tone: Incorporating Kojic Acid into Your Routine
Achieving a consistently even skin tone is a common goal in skincare. Hyperpigmentation, whether from sun exposure, acne, or melasma, can detract from skin clarity. Kojic Acid, a potent natural ingredient, is celebrated for its ability to brighten the skin and reduce the appearance of dark spots. Understanding how to effectively incorporate it into your routine is key to unlocking its full potential.
Kojic Acid works by inhibiting tyrosinase, an enzyme critical for melanin production. This action directly targets the source of discoloration, making it a highly effective ingredient for fading dark spots and achieving a more uniform complexion. The Kojic Acid benefits for hyperpigmentation are well-documented, making it a staple in many brightening skincare products.
When considering how to use Kojic Acid serum, the best approach often involves consistency and proper application. Start by cleansing your skin thoroughly. Apply a few drops of Kojic Acid serum to the areas of concern or to your entire face, gently patting it in until absorbed. It’s generally recommended to use serums in the evening to allow the ingredient to work without interference from UV exposure. Remember to always follow up with a moisturizer to keep your skin hydrated, as some individuals may experience dryness. Starting with application a few times a week and gradually increasing as your skin tolerates it is a wise strategy.
For those also interested in other brightening agents, the comparison of Kojic Acid vs Vitamin C for dark spots can be helpful. While both can brighten the skin, Kojic Acid offers a more direct melanin-inhibiting action. Some individuals find success using both ingredients, but it’s best to introduce them one at a time or on alternate nights to avoid potential irritation.
For individuals specifically looking for safe skin brightening ingredients during pregnancy, Kojic Acid is often considered a good option when used topically and in appropriate concentrations. However, consulting a healthcare professional is always the best first step for pregnant individuals exploring new skincare ingredients.
